Welcome to the Fatigue Countermeasure Training Course. In this course you will learn the basics about fatigue, sleep, and fatigue risk management.
 
We have packaged the information to keep you interested and involved. The first segment of the training will consist of a 20 minute video entitled “Grounded”. This action-packed thriller is not your average government training video. Pay attention to this fast paced video and learn how fatigue can impact your family, your health, and your job.
 
The second segment (32 min) of the training will cover fatigue basics. In particular, it will identify some of the fatigue hazards that you may be exposed to in your life and the dangerous effects it can have. In this section, you will learn about what causes fatigue and how to look for symptoms.
 
The third segment (24 min) of the training will cover sleep basics. This section will describe why your mind and body become fatigued so you can more effectively look for solutions.

The fourth segment (40 min) will identify methods you can use to effectively prevent or combat fatigue.  This segment provides solutions or recommendations that you might receive from a sleep doctor. Use the information in this segment and begin applying it to your life.  You might be surprised how a few fatigue countermeasures can improve your mood, health, and safety. A little extra sleep can change how you interact with your family, friends, coworkers, and even the people you drive by on your way to work.

Average time to complete this course is approximately 2.5 hours.
